Ingredients
- 14 oz chopped tomatoes
- 1/2 onion
- 9 oz shell pasta
- 4 1/2 cups vegetable stock
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h coriander or cilantro for garnish
Instructions
- Chop tomatoes and onion into rough pieces.
- Blend chopped tomatoes and onion in a food processor until smooth.
- In a large pot over medium heat, add olive oil and shell pasta; cook until golden brown.
- Pour in blended tomato mixture; stir well and simmer for a few minutes.
- Add vegetable stock; mix thoroughly and bring to a gentle simmer.
- Cook until pasta is al dente, then remove from heat.
- Serve hot, garnished with fresh coriander or cilantro.
